Meritorious Service Medal
|
Conditions of Eligibility and Eligible
Categories
Awarded on Republic and Independence Day by the respective Chiefs of
Staff to selected individuals from the following categories of
personnel who have a minimum of 15 years service distinguished by
highly good conduct: -
Army - Havildars and Dafadars
Navy - Chief Petty Officers, Petty officers and their
equivalent in other branches.
Air Force - Warrant Officers, Flight Sergeants and Sergeants.
For the purpose of the award only such service as counts for pension
and gratuity is taken into consideration.
There shall be fixed establishment for the award of the medal to
each service which shall be determined by the Government from time
to tome. Vacancies in the establishment shall be filled on the
death, discharge, deduction in rank of promotion to a Commissioned
rank of a recipient or on forfeiture of the medal
Design of the Medal and Ribbon
Medal - Circular in shape, 1.42 inches in diameter and made
of standard silver. It shall have embossed on the obverse the State
Emblem seven-eighth inches in height with the motto
------------------------decorative lotus buds along the periphery.
On the reverse it shall have the inscriptions “FOR MERITORIOUS
SERVICE” and “--------------------------------------------“ within a
lotus wreath. The medal shall have scroll pattern swivel fitting one
and five-sixteenth inches in width for the riband.
Ribbon - Brown silk, one and a quarter inches in width, edged
with white and divided equally by three narrow vertical stripes each
one-sixteenth of an inch in red, dark blue and light blue.
Monetary benefits
An annuity of Rs. 100/- for the first year will be paid to the
recipient on the award of the medal. For the second and subsequent
year, full annuity will be paid. Only for every completed service
period of 12 months. For service less than 12 months in the second
and subsequent years, the annuity will be admissible
proportionately.
